Oppo Launching Their Latest Reno 16 Series in Pakistan on 31st August
Oppo Reno 16 series launches in Pakistan on 31st August. Reno 16 at Rs. 199,999 and Reno 16F at Rs. 149,000 — check full specs, camera, and battery details.
Oppo is officially bringing its Reno 16 series to Pakistan on 31st August, with two models arriving in the local lineup — the flagship Oppo Reno 16 and the more affordable Oppo Reno 16F. Both phones come PTA approved with full local warranty, so buyers won't have to deal with the usual import hassle.
Oppo Reno 16 — Rs. 199,999 (12GB/256GB)
The Reno 16 sits at the top of the series and is built around a compact 6.32-inch AMOLED display with a 120Hz refresh rate, HDR10+, and up to 3600 nits peak brightness — a proper flagship-grade panel. It runs on the Qualcomm Snapdragon 7 Gen 4 chipset paired with 12GB of RAM and 256GB of UFS 3.1 storage, though there's no card slot for expansion.
Camera-wise, it packs a genuine triple 50MP setup — a main sensor with OIS, a 3.5x optical telephoto lens with OIS, and an ultrawide lens — plus a 50MP selfie camera up front. Powering it all is a 6700mAh battery with 80W wired fast charging, getting a full charge in about 59 minutes. The phone also carries an IP68/IP69K rating for dust and water resistance, including high-pressure water jets, and ships with Android 16 and ColorOS 16. It's available in Pop White, Twilight Violet, and Dream Purple.
Oppo Reno 16F — Rs. 149,000 (8GB/256GB)
The Reno 16F trades some of the flagship polish for battery life and value. It has a slightly larger 6.57-inch AMOLED display, also at 120Hz, running on the more efficiency-focused MediaTek Dimensity 7300 Energy chipset. RAM and storage options range from 8GB/128GB up to 12GB/256GB, and unlike the standard Reno 16, it does include a microSDXC card slot for expandable storage.
Its camera setup is also a triple system with a 50MP main sensor and a real 3.5x optical zoom telephoto lens — a rare feature at this price — alongside an 8MP ultrawide and a 50MP selfie camera. The standout, though, is the battery: a massive 7000mAh cell with 80W wired charging, easily good for two days of moderate use. It also carries the same IP68/IP69K rating as its sibling, and ships with Android 16 and ColorOS 16 in the same three color options.

The Bottom Line
The Reno 16 is the pick for buyers who want the sharper camera hardware and Snapdragon performance, while the Reno 16F makes more sense for anyone who prioritizes battery life and value — its 7000mAh battery and 3.5x zoom camera are hard to find together at Rs. 149,000. Both phones go on sale in Pakistan from 31st August.
